首頁 > Java > java教程 > 主體

java框架在人工智慧自動化中的作用是什麼?

WBOY
發布: 2024-06-02 19:36:01
原創
901 人瀏覽過

Java 框架在人工智慧自動化中提供高效且可擴展的解決方案。常見框架包括 TensorFlow、PyTorch、Keras 和 Weka。使用 Java 框架進行自動化涉及準備資料、選擇演算法、訓練模型、部署模型和自動化任務。例如,可以透過使用 TensorFlow 訓練影像分類模型並使用 Java 包裝器整合到應用程式中來實現影像分類自動化。

java框架在人工智慧自動化中的作用是什麼?

Java 框架在人工智慧自動化中的作用

隨著人工智慧(AI) 的興起,自動化已成為許多行業的重中之重。 Java 框架在人工智慧自動化中扮演著至關重要的角色,提供高效、可擴展且可維護的解決方案。

常見Java 框架

用於人工智慧自動化的幾個流行Java 框架包括:

  • TensorFlow: 開源機器學習庫,用於建立和訓練模型。
  • PyTorch: 動態神經網路框架,易於除錯和視覺化。
  • Keras: TensorFlow 和 Theano 上的進階 API,用於快速原型設計。
  • weka: 專注於資料探勘、機器學習和視覺化的平台。

如何使用Java 框架進行自動化

以下步驟概述了使用Java 框架進行人工智慧自動化的流程:

  1. #準備資料:收集和清理用於訓練模型的資料。
  2. 選擇合適的演算法:根據具體任務選擇合適的機器學習演算法。
  3. 訓練模型:使用選定的框架訓練演算法,建立預測模型。
  4. 部署模型:將訓練好的模型部署到生產環境中進行推理。
  5. 自動化任務:使用 Java 整合了機器學習模型自動執行任務。

實戰案例

影像分類自動化

假設您希望自動化影像分類過程,以便根據影像內容對影像進行自動分類。您可以使用下列步驟:

  • 使用 TensorFlow 訓練影像分類模型。
  • 將訓練好的模型部署到應用程式伺服器。
  • 使用 Java 包裝器存取模型並預測圖像類別。

透過此方法,您可以自動對影像進行分類,而無需手動輸入。

其他應用程式

Java 框架在人工智慧自動化中還有許多其他應用,包括:

  • 自然語言處理
  • 語音辨識
  • 電腦視覺
  • 詐欺偵測
  • 客戶服務

以上是java框架在人工智慧自動化中的作用是什麼?的詳細內容。更多資訊請關注PHP中文網其他相關文章!

相關標籤:
來源:php.cn
本網站聲明
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n
最新問題
熱門教學
更多>
最新下載
更多>
網站特效
網站源碼
網站素材
前端模板